Repeating discs and tracks

1. Ensure that the disc is loaded.
2. Press the Repeat Track button on the remote control. 'RPT-TRK' will appear on the
display. The current track will now be repeated until the function is turned off by
pressing Repeat Track button.
3. Press the Repeat All button on the remote control. 'RPT-ALL' will appear on the
display. The whole disc will now be repeated until the function is turned off by
pressing Repeat All button.

Playing tracks in random order

1. Ensure that a disc is loaded.
2. Press the Random/Shuffle button on the remote control. 'RANDOM' will appear on
the display.
3. The CD player will automatically play the entire disc in random order.
4. Press Random/Shuffle to exit the function. 'RAN-OFF' will appear on the display.
The disc will continue playing to the end in the correct order.
5. Press the Stop/Eject button at any time to stop the disc and exit Random mode.
Note: Selecting 'Random/Shuffle' mode when 'Repeat Track' or 'Repeat All' has been
selected will automatically cancel 'Repeat Track' or 'Repeat All' mode.
